The Uffizi Gallery is one of the most renowned art museums in the world. It houses a rich collection of masterpieces spanning from early Byzantine art to Renaissance and Baroque periods. Visitors begin their journey with artists like Cimabue and Giotto whose works show religious devotion and early stylistic innovations. The tour continues with Renaissance geniuses such as Leonardo da Vinci and Raphael who introduced new techniques perspective and human emotion into their paintings. Baroque masters including Michelangelo and Caravaggio bring drama and intensity to the gallery. Observing these works closely allows visitors to appreciate the fine details brushwork and composition that have influenced generations of artists around the globe.
The gallery also highlights connections between teachers and students and the evolution of artistic styles over time. Filippo Lippi’s delicate Madonnas influenced Botticelli whose Birth of Venus and Primavera remain some of the most famous works in the collection. Leonardo da Vinci’s Adoration of the Magi shows the genius of unfinished art while Michelangelo’s Doni Tondo demonstrates the Florentine love for circular paintings. Raphael’s intimate portrait of Pope Leo X and his cousin Clement VII captures personality and status with remarkable detail. Walking through the Uffizi Gallery allows visitors to experience the development of European art across centuries and see how artists inspired one another. The museum experience combines education and aesthetic enjoyment while connecting visitors to the cultural and historical significance of these masterpieces.
